Mizuno has rebounded nicely from a nearly fatal mistake of releasing a sub par performing blur early in the season. Dont get me wrong, the BLUR wasnt by any means a terrible bat, it just wasnt anything near what the Crush or even Fury/Rage were... The new Envy is everything you would expect from the makers of the crush, and will definately be one of the top selling bats of the new year. It has a great feel, and is amazingly endloaded for an ASA bat... I had no trouble swinging the 27oz bat after swinging my b1 27oz EL for over 4 months... The switch was simple and only took about 4-5 swings to get used to the new bat... The envy has to be broken in, so please give it at least 200 swings before you judge it... Anything before then and you wont be seeing its true performance. This bat is great for all compression balls, as we tested it with .40 375, .44 375, .44 525, .47 525, and even .50 525 balls... It hit them all very well, and was performing even with the crappy .40 cor's... My test model has approx 500 swings on it with no signs of any dents, cracks or other failure. I would say if your looking for a top tier bat, but dont want to spend $300+, then the $249 Envy is the bat for you!

Sweet Spot & Overall Feel 17 of 20
Distance & Ball Flight 17 of 20
Durability 19 of 20
Swing Weight & Feel 17 of 20
Overall Feel/Performance: COMBINED 18 of 20
Score: 88 of 100
